Unravel for PlayStation 4 takes players on an emotional journey as they embody the endearing character, Yarny. Developed by Coldwood Interactive and published by Electronic Arts, this game aims to mend broken bonds and evoke a sense of nostalgia reminiscent of the golden age of gaming.
Yarny, a heartfelt creature made entirely of yarn, represents the love and connection between people. With its thread, Yarny embarks on a mission to mend these broken bonds. The concept, though simple, is executed with poignancy, capturing the essence of human relationships in a unique and charming way.
As players guide Yarny through various levels, they are met with stunning visuals that evoke a warm sense of nostalgia. The artistic design seamlessly blends natural landscapes with a touch of whimsy, creating a picturesque backdrop for Yarny's adventure.
Utilizing Yarny's thread is where Unravel truly shines, challenging gamers to think creatively and utilize the thread in clever ways. From swinging across treacherous gaps to rappelling down trees, this mechanic adds depth and excitement to the gameplay, making each level feel like a puzzle waiting to be solved.
However, while Unravel succeeds in capturing the nostalgia and sentimental value of classic games, it falls short in other aspects. The gameplay can at times feel repetitive, with certain levels lacking the same creativity present in others. Additionally, occasional technical glitches can dampen the overall experience, hindering the seamless flow of gameplay.
